The heat is on, and employers are feeling the pressure like never before. A changing workforce, uncertain economy, ever-changing (and sometimes conflicting) laws with no clear guidance, hidden surprises in the law, ramped-up enforcement initiatives by state and federal authorities, and the increased potential for litigation only add to the pressures of everyday life in the workplace.

In the presentation titled “Surprise! Emerging gender identity benefits issues and unexpected traps in the ACA,” employee benefits attorney Bill Freudenrich discusses the emerging issue of gender dysphoria and whether Oklahoma state law or the Affordable Care Act requires health plans to cover any types of procedures or treatment related to gender dysphoria. Also in the presentation, employee benefits attorney Barbara Klepper discusses lesser-known aspects of the ACA, including how employers should count employee hours of service under the “play or pay” mandate, the proper use of health reimbursement arrangements (HRAs) and employer payment plans (EPPs), and FSA carryover guidelines.
